If the door is misaligned, follow these actions to accomplish correct alignment:
Inspect the Hinges: Check for screws that are loose or missing.Adjust the Hinges: Use a screwdriver or Allen secret to tighten any loose screws. If the door requires to be raised or lowered, try to find adjustment screws on the hinge plates.Test the Door: Open and close the door numerous times to guarantee it runs smoothly. If required, repeat the adjustments.4. Fixing Weatherstripping Damage
To change broken weatherstripping:
Remove Old Weatherstripping: Carefully peel away old weatherstripping from the door frame.Clean the Surface: Clean the location where brand-new weatherstripping will be used, ensuring it's devoid of dirt and particles.Install New Weatherstripping: Cut the replacement weatherstripping to size and press it securely into place.5. Regular maintenance can assist avoid many common UPVC door concerns. Here are some suggestions:
Regularly Clean: Use mild cleaning agent to tidy doors and frames to prevent dirt build-up.Inspect Hardware: Periodically check locks, deals with, and hinges for signs of wear.Oil Moving Parts: Regularly lube hinges and locks to preserve smooth operation.Examine Weatherstripping: Inspect weatherstripping for damage and replace as necessary.Frequently asked questionsQ1: How typically should I preserve my UPVC door?
It is suggested to examine and preserve your UPVC door a minimum of two times a year, or more often if you discover any problems.
Q2: Can I fix a misaligned door myself?
Yes, many misalignment problems can be fixed with basic tools and a bit of knowledge. If you're uncertain, consult a professional.
Q3: What should I use to clean my UPVC door?
A moderate cleaning agent blended with water is generally adequate. Avoid utilizing abrasive cleaners that might damage the surface.
Q4: How do I know if my lock requires to be changed?
If the lock is tough to operate, shows visible wear, or if the key does not turn smoothly, it may need replacement.
